E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
CriteriaBuilder
spring boot 中JPA使用动态SQL查询
基本上有以下两种办法:方法一:用criteria查询importjavax.persistence.criteria.
CriteriaBuilder
;importjavax.persistence.criteria.CriteriaQuery
echo_adc8
·
2023-10-30 23:25
Criteria Queries使用详解
CriteriaBuilderByCriteriaBuildercriteriaBuilder=session.getCriteriaBuilder();然后根据要找的对象生成CriteriaQueryCriteriaQuerycriteriaQuery=
criteriaBuilder
.createQuery
Max_Liu_95
·
2023-10-30 04:49
jpa MySQL 使用like查询数据
1、jpa关键字查询:2、使用
criteriaBuilder
添加查询条件:if(StringUtils.isNotBlank(name)){list.add(
criteriaBuilder
.like(root.get
冰淇淋分你一半
·
2023-10-17 18:43
项目
java
java中的TreeMap
TreeMap集合packagedailyTest;importjavax.persistence.criteria.
CriteriaBuilder
;importjava.util.StringJoiner
菜鸟教程*…*
·
2023-10-09 15:20
java
开发语言
Map集合案例-统计投票人数
利用Map集合进行统计//A06_HashMapDemo2.javapackagedailyTest;importjavax.persistence.criteria.
CriteriaBuilder
;importjava.util
菜鸟教程*…*
·
2023-10-09 15:49
java
springboot jpa 使用Predicate进行in条件查询
){ListpredicateList=newArrayList0){predicateList.add(root.get("xxx").in(list));}criteriaQuery.where(
criteriaBuilder
.a
wangjw.bug
·
2023-08-30 13:19
程序员开发笔记
spring
boot
后端
java
springboot+restful+jpa示例
importjava.util.ArrayList;importjava.util.HashMap;importjava.util.List;importjava.util.Map;importjavax.persistence.criteria.
CriteriaBuilder
小爪哇海
·
2023-08-20 22:24
Spring JPA实现多条件查询,全部条件查询
,StringsearchType,StringsearchContext){//1.构造自定义查询条件SpecificationqueryCondition=(root,criteriaQuery,
criteriaBuilder
李楷杰
·
2023-08-04 14:25
spring
数据库
java
CriteriaBuilder
联合查询
publicListfindProdFactoryDesc(Stringprodtype,StringprodName){CriteriaBuildercb=entityManager.getCriteriaBuilder();CriteriaQuerycq=cb.createQuery(String.class);Rootprt=cq.from(Product.class);Rootfct=cq
lianghyan
·
2023-07-29 10:20
windows
microsoft
linux
Spring JPA
CriteriaBuilder
分页查询
packagerepository;importjava.util.List;importorg.springframework.beans.factory.annotation.Autowired;importorg.springframework.data.domain.Sort;importorg.springframework.stereotype.Repository;importjak
lianghyan
·
2023-07-29 10:17
windows
JPA复杂查询之Predicate
cb.between(root.get("date"),dateBefore,dateAfter));2、in的使用predicates.add(root.get("type").in(typeList));
CriteriaBuilder
.Inin
负熵流
·
2023-04-07 18:21
java
jpa
将A~Z映射成1~26
1、简单粗暴哈希表importjavafx.collections.MapChangeListener;importjavax.persistence.criteria.
CriteriaBuilder
;
宇宙超级无敌狂拽霹雳魔法暴龙战神
·
2023-04-03 17:22
java
小技巧
蓝桥杯
java
Java8中的Stream流式运算大全实战
importorg.junit.jupiter.api.Test;importorg.springframework.boot.test.context.SpringBootTest;importjavax.persistence.criteria.
CriteriaBuilder
咸鱼的想法
·
2023-03-29 06:16
java
spring
boot
spring
1024程序员节
spring-data-jpa 简单查询:封装及使用
packagecom.lky.commons.specification;importorg.springframework.data.jpa.domain.Specification;importjavax.persistence.criteria.
CriteriaBuilder
luckyhua
·
2023-03-22 20:36
Spring JPA使用
CriteriaBuilder
动态构造查询方式
目录SpringJPA使用
CriteriaBuilder
动态构造查询JPACriteriaBuilder中一些运算的使用SpringJPA使用
CriteriaBuilder
动态构造查询在使用SpringJPA
·
2022-04-26 19:22
Spingboot JPA
CriteriaBuilder
如何获取指定字段
目录SpingbootJPACriteriaBuilder获取指定字段JavaJPACriteriaBuilder使用一个复杂的查询例子SpingbootJPACriteriaBuilder获取指定字段废话不说直接贴代码publicclassActivityVOimplementsSerializable{privatestaticfinallongserialVersionUID=1L;priv
·
2022-03-28 13:08
在JPA中
criteriabuilder
使用or拼接多个like语句
目录
criteriabuilder
使用or拼接多个like语句sql语句类似于sql语句如下java-jpa-
criteriabuilder
使用一个复杂的查询例子
criteriabuilder
使用or拼接多个
·
2022-03-03 12:48
JPA
CriteriaBuilder
子查询方式
目录JPACriteriaBuilder子查询Jpa在
CriteriaBuilder
中添加where条件NotIn子查询JPACriteriaBuilder子查询给自己做个备忘/**检索关键字*/if(
·
2021-12-07 13:33
用Hibernate实现分页查询
Page类,下面是一个Page类,我对其做了详细的注解:1packagecom.entity;2/**3*@author:秦林森4*/56importjavax.persistence.criteria.
CriteriaBuilder
dengpengfu4092
·
2020-09-15 07:07
java
数据库
java-jpa-
criteriaBuilder
简介及用法
80157975importjavax.persistence.EntityManager;importjavax.persistence.PersistenceContext;importjavax.persistence.criteria.
CriteriaBuilder
林会
·
2020-09-12 03:18
java
为什么SpringDataJPA中的Specification类型可以兼容
criteriaBuilder
生成的Predicate
前言在之前的文章Spring中
CriteriaBuilder
.In的使用中,留下了一个悬念:为什么SpringDataJPA中的Specification类型可以兼容
criteriaBuilder
生成的
LYX6666
·
2020-08-24 18:05
specifications
criteria查询
spring-data-jpa
jpa
java
java-jpa-
criteriaBuilder
使用
CriteriaBuildercriteriaBuilder=entityManager.getCriteriaBuilder();//查询结果所需要的类型(Entity相对应)CriteriaQuerycriteriaQuery=
criteriaBuilder
.createQuery
IT_小斯
·
2020-08-23 15:14
Hibernate
JAVA
为什么SpringDataJPA中的Specification类型可以兼容
criteriaBuilder
生成的Predicate
前言在之前的文章Spring中
CriteriaBuilder
.In的使用中,留下了一个悬念:为什么SpringDataJPA中的Specification类型可以兼容
criteriaBuilder
生成的
LYX6666
·
2020-08-21 04:05
specifications
criteria查询
spring-data-jpa
jpa
java
Spring中
CriteriaBuilder
.In
的使用
.in方法的用途Criteria意为“标准、准则”,在数据库中翻译为“查询条件”,所以CriteriaBuider就是Java提供的、用来生成查询条件的“标准生成器”。Criteria的in方法对应SOL语句中的IN关键字。比如,//在student表中查询所有班级id为1或2的学生SELECT*FROM`student`WHEREklass_idIN(1,2);因此in的作用就是:判断一条记录的
LYX6666
·
2020-08-21 03:52
criteria查询
in
specifications
jpa
java
Hibernate @ManyToMany 级联子查询
query.setPredicate(((root,criteriaQuery,
criteriaBuilder
,list,list1)->{//根据分类id查询中间表过滤商品分类ObjectcategoryId
乐摸森先生
·
2020-08-15 18:57
JPA时间段查询
传入一个开始时间(beginDate)以及结束时间(endDate)与某个时间(someTime)进行比较:restrictions=
criteriaBuilder
.and(restrictions,
criteriaBuilder
.greaterThanOrEqualTo
weixin_33720078
·
2020-08-11 23:05
jpa查询笔记之
CriteriaBuilder
类和Predicate类
CriteriaBuilder
是一个工厂类,用来创建安全查询的criteriaQuery对象。该对象是用来构建查询的。
千篇不一律
·
2020-08-09 11:28
SSH
springboot
criteriabuilder
in 查询语句怎么写
criteriaBuilder
.in得到In对象,可以用于添加in的列表Pathpath=root.get("hospId");
CriteriaBuilder
.Inin=
criteriaBuilder
.in
chenglan5153
·
2020-08-09 07:26
Jpa的
criteriaBuilder
.in使用
类似于Sql:wherestatusin(1,2,3)Pathpath=root.get("status");
CriteriaBuilder
.Inin=
criteriaBuilder
.in(path);
o_oer
·
2020-08-09 06:37
Hibernate
Spring中
CriteriaBuilder
.In
的使用
.in方法的用途Criteria意为“标准、准则”,在数据库中翻译为“查询条件”,所以CriteriaBuider就是Java提供的、用来生成查询条件的“标准生成器”。Criteria的in方法对应SOL语句中的IN关键字。比如,//在student表中查询所有班级id为1或2的学生SELECT*FROM`student`WHEREklass_idIN(1,2);因此in的作用就是:判断一条记录的
LYX6666
·
2020-08-01 07:03
criteria查询
in
specifications
jpa
java
JPA自定义VO接受返回结果集(unwrap)
@Query直接写SQL,缺点是无法动态的组装条件2.JPA的Specification对象动态组装where搜索条件3.entityManager执行
CriteriaBuilder
4.entityManger
乐闻x
·
2020-07-31 20:22
Java
mysql
JPA
Spring JPA使用Specification进行动态查询
在SpringJPA使用
CriteriaBuilder
动态构造查询中,我们大致看了使用
CriteriaBuilder
如何进行动态查询。
一路斜阳
·
2020-07-15 12:49
SpringBoot
mysql
spring
jpa
JpaRepository动态查询sql
JpaRepository动态查询sql在使用前,需要导入importjavax.persistence.EntityManager;importjavax.persistence.criteria.
CriteriaBuilder
君君百分百
·
2020-07-15 09:18
JPA2.0
criteriaBuilder
模糊查询和高级选择搜索查询
需求JPA2.0
criteriaBuilder
高级处理模糊查询和高级选择搜索查询解决:1.如果使用SQL拼接使用的是连续的if(){}if(){}…来拼接字符串2.jpa则需要使用
criteriaBuilder
leohorry
·
2020-07-15 06:23
Specification中一个条件用或者表示(
criteriaBuilder
.or)
Specificationspec=(root,criteriaQuery,
criteriaBuilder
)->{Listpredicate=newArrayList<>();Predicatepred1
大焦涛
·
2020-07-15 06:20
Java
criteriaBuilder
springdataJPA中带查询条件的分页in的用法in的用法和equal,like,or的用法不同,以下给出in的用法!@OverridepublicPredicatetoPredicate(Rootroot,CriteriaQuerycriteriaQuery,CriteriaBuildercriteriaBuilder){ Listlist=newArrayListids=per
qq_41987575
·
2020-07-14 20:35
CriteriaBuilder
封装查询
packagecom.topsec.tsm.util;importcom.google.gson.reflect.TypeToken;importcom.topsec.tsm.common.WhereEqual;importorg.apache.commons.lang.StringUtils;importorg.springframework.data.jpa.domain.Specificat
梵高的夏天
·
2020-07-14 17:20
Spring JPA使用
CriteriaBuilder
动态构造查询
这里我们来看使用
CriteriaBuilder
如何来构造查询。
一路斜阳
·
2020-07-14 03:28
SpringBoot
springboot jpa and or 合并 一起 查询
Listlist=newArrayList();Listintegers=recursionData(newArrayListpath=root.get("dept");
CriteriaBuilder
.Inin
爱糖的小色猪
·
2020-07-14 02:15
SpringBoot
JPA之Specification多条件搜索
importjavax.persistence.criteria.
CriteriaBuilder
;importjavax.persistence.criteria.CriteriaQuery;importjavax.persistence.criteria.Predicate
li_tiantian
·
2020-07-14 01:58
SpringDataJPA Hibernate
CriteriaBuilder
日期模糊查询
在
CriteriaBuilder
中有一个function函数,可以通过此方法对日期数据转换成字符串数据然后再进行模糊查询例如://我的开发语言Kotlin,相信你可以很容易的把下面两行代码转化为JavavaltimeStr
weixin_34417635
·
2020-07-12 10:34
springbootJpa Specification实现mysql中json字段查询
需求SELECTorder0_.idASid1_53_WHEREJSON_EXTRACT(order0_.ext_obj,'$.type')=1jpa写法predicateList.add(
criteriaBuilder
.equal
Anliexo
·
2020-07-11 17:20
hibernate
java
SpringDataJPA学习记录(三)--复杂查询的封装
SpringDataJPA学习记录(三)–复杂查询的封装标签(空格分隔):springJPA1.使用
CriteriaBuilder
构建JPQL在UserRepositoryImpl中使用
CriteriaBuilder
茶饮月
·
2020-07-05 17:51
jpa
javaWEB实战
hibernate5关联查询和条件查询以及统计查询
count()和sum()使用原生sql进行关联查询并完成参数传递,结果封装,结果装json输出使用jpql/hql语句完成关联查询对两个实体进行关联映射OneToMany、ManyToOne完成关联查询使用
CriteriaBuilder
千篇不一律
·
2020-07-05 08:07
后端
springboot
orm框架
JPA中
criteriabuilder
使用or拼接多个like语句
项目中有两张表,一张角色和机构的关系表role_work_site_relation,存放的是机构的id和角色的id,另一张表member_info表中存放用户相关信息。机构为树形结构,role_work_site_relation中存放的是当前角色中的所有机构id。查询member_info时需要根据role_work_site_relation查询到有权限的相应机构下的数据。而member_i
蓝色格子
·
2020-07-04 16:41
java
Spring JPA in查询
List>querySpecs=newArrayListroot,CriteriaQueryquery,CriteriaBuildercriteriaBuilder)->
criteriaBuilder
.equal
oQiuZe
·
2020-07-02 13:52
JPA
CriteriaBuilder
jpa 日期date查询
概要:前端日期选择器选择完之后传一个String到后台,后台的字段的数据类型是date前端:单据日期//单据日期laydate.render({elem:'#taxDate',type:'date'//默认,可不填});后端:@OverridepublicPagefindPage(SalesOrderModelsalesOrderModel,intcurrentPage,intpageSize){
weixin_30532987
·
2020-06-27 21:22
Spring Data JPA 动态拼接条件的通用设计模式
importjava.sql.Timestamp;importjava.util.ArrayList;importjava.util.List;importjavax.persistence.criteria.
CriteriaBuilder
dengken829873708
·
2020-06-23 03:53
SpringDataJPA学习记录(三)--复杂查询的封装
SpringDataJPA学习记录(三)--复杂查询的封装标签(空格分隔):springJPA1.使用
CriteriaBuilder
构建JPQL在UserRepositoryImpl中使用
CriteriaBuilder
此博废弃_更新在个人博客
·
2020-03-13 10:54
Spring Boot jpa Service层实现代码
packagecom.fei.service.impl;importjava.util.ArrayList;importjava.util.List;importjavax.persistence.criteria.
CriteriaBuilder
行之间
·
2019-10-03 23:00
上一页
1
2
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他